Top Definition
"Hello Japan" is a subset of failure (fail). A "Hello Japan" scenario is where an individual's attempt to respond to a dangerous situation with humor or a casual attitude ends with pain and/or humiliation.
David strolled across the street playing chicken with the speeding car and got run over. It was his "Hello Japan" moment.
by saku_by_kimura November 25, 2009

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.